Glasgow, Scotland's largest city, is a vibrant hub of culture, history, and, importantly, food. For those who follow a gluten-free diet, whether due to celiac disease, gluten intolerance, or personal preference, finding safe and delicious dining options can be a challenge. Fortunately, Glasgow has embraced the gluten-free movement with open arms, offering a wide array of restaurants, cafes, and bakeries that cater to gluten-free needs. In this guide, we’ll explore the best gluten-free food options in Glasgow, from cozy cafes to fine dining establishments, and provide you with all the information you need to enjoy a gluten-free culinary adventure in this bustling city.
Glasgow has become a hotspot for gluten-free dining, thanks to its diverse food scene and the increasing awareness of dietary restrictions. The city boasts a variety of eateries that not only offer gluten-free options but also prioritize cross-contamination prevention, ensuring a safe dining experience for those with celiac disease. From traditional Scottish dishes to international cuisines, Glasgow’s gluten-free offerings are both extensive and delicious.

Yes, Glasgow has several dedicated gluten-free restaurants, such as the Gluten-Free Bakery on Byres Road, which offers a 100% gluten-free menu.
Absolutely! Many traditional Scottish restaurants, like Two Fat Ladies at The Buttery, offer gluten-free options upon request. Always inform the staff of your dietary needs.
Yes, major supermarkets like Tesco and Sainsbury's have extensive gluten-free sections, offering everything from bread to ready meals.
Always inform your server about your gluten-free requirements. Many restaurants in Glasgow are well-versed in handling gluten-free requests and can guide you through the menu.
